I would love to have some potato leek soup right now. <br /><br />Another thing you could do with those potatoes and leeks - sour cream and leek mashed potatoes. Saute chopped leeks in butter until tender. Mix in to your mashed potatoes. Stir in some sour cream. Yuuuuummm. Have the courage NOT to add that onion. Melt the butter and sweat the leeks. Soften the tatties and then add the liquid. Cook until ready to liquidise adding plenty of cream (heavy or light) and pepper (black - even though it detracts a bit from the colour).
